

# 使用 CUPS 服務搭配 AWS IoT Core for LoRaWAN 來更新閘道韌體
<a name="lorawan-update-firmware"></a>

在閘道上執行的 [LoRa Basics Station](https://doc.sm.tc/station) 軟體會使用組態與更新伺服器 (CUPS) 通訊協定，提供憑證管理和韌體更新界面。CUPS 通訊協定提供安全韌體更新交付與 ECDSA 簽章。

您必須經常更新閘道的韌體。您可以使用 CUPS 服務搭配 AWS IoT Core for LoRaWAN，為閘道提供韌體更新，而這些更新也可以在此閘道中進行簽署。若要更新閘道的韌體，您可以使用 SDK 或 CLI，但不能使用主控台。

更新程序約需 45 分鐘才能完成。如果您是第一次設定閘道來連接至 AWS IoT Core for LoRaWAN，可能需要更長的時間。閘道製造商通常會提供自己的韌體更新檔案和簽章，因此您可以改用這些檔案和簽章，然後繼續進行 [將韌體檔案上傳至 S3 儲存貯體並新增 IAM 角色](lorawan-upload-firmware-s3bucket.md)。

如果您沒有韌體更新檔案，請參閱[產生韌體更新檔案和簽章](lorawan-script-fwupdate-sigkey.md)，以取得您可以用來改編以適應您應用程式的範例。

**Topics**
+ [產生韌體更新檔案和簽章](lorawan-script-fwupdate-sigkey.md)
+ [將韌體檔案上傳至 S3 儲存貯體並新增 IAM 角色](lorawan-upload-firmware-s3bucket.md)
+ [使用任務定義來排程和執行韌體更新](lorawan-schedule-firmware-update.md)